A '''hull''' is the shotgun shell equivalent of a case, but is otherwise identical in function.
Cases and hulls may be found in one of two states: '''Unprimed/Spent''' and '''Primed'''. The term "spent case" specifically refers to the case that remains after a round has been fired, but otherwise, they are considered identical to unprimed (as in, brand new, never loaded) cases, in that they do not have a live primer inserted. A '''primed case''' is a case with a fresh primer inserted, ready for the next steps of handloading.
Unprimed cases can be found for sale at gun shops and weapon shops, in boxes of 50. Primed cases can never be found or purchased; they have to be made, as part of the process of handloading.
